Camera Panasonic Lumix DMC-FS15

The Panasonic Lumix DMC-FS15 camera is a compact model that stands out for its exceptional image quality. With a 12.1 Megapixel CMOS sensor and a maximum resolution of 4000 x 3000 pixels, it allows you to capture every detail with great precision. Thanks to its image stabilizer, photos and videos remain sharp, even in motion.

The Lumix DMC-FS15 is equipped with a 9.8x optical zoom and a 4x digital zoom, providing flexibility for photographing distant subjects. The LEICA DC VARIO-ELMAR lens system ensures superior image quality, while its shutter speed ranging from 8 to 1/2000 s allows for sharp photos, even in low light conditions.

Featuring a 2.7-inch LCD screen, the camera offers an immersive visual experience with a resolution of 230000 pixels. Weighing only 117.934 g and with a sleek blue design, it is easy to carry and use on a daily basis. In terms of connectivity, it has a USB 2.0 port for quick image transfer.

In summary, the Panasonic Lumix DMC-FS15 is an ideal compact camera for capturing precious moments with remarkable image quality and intuitive use.

Editorial note

The Panasonic Lumix DMC-FS15 is a compact camera that stands out for its exceptional image quality, thanks to a 12.1 MP CMOS sensor. Users will appreciate the maximum resolution of 4000 x 3000 pixels, which allows for capturing precise details. The built-in image stabilizer ensures sharp photos and videos, even in motion, providing a pleasant user experience. The various scene modes, such as Portrait and Night, make it easy to optimize settings based on different environments. However, this device has some drawbacks. Its video capability is limited to a resolution of 848 x 480 pixels, which may disappoint those looking for better quality for their recordings. Additionally, the 2.7-inch LCD screen, while of good quality, is not tiltable, which can complicate composing shots from certain angles. The internal memory of only 50 MB can quickly prove insufficient, necessitating the use of external memory cards. Finally, the nickel-metal hybrid battery (NiMH) technology may not offer the same longevity as lithium-ion batteries, potentially leading to more frequent replacements. In terms of performance, the camera receives a good rating, with a score of 75, while the battery life is rated at 85, which is ideal for extended outings. Its modern and attractive design, rated at 78, is also a strong point, although the fixed screen size limits certain usage possibilities. Finally, the value for money is considered fair, with a score of 70, but the mentioned limitations may influence the overall experience. In summary, the Panasonic Lumix DMC-FS15 is a solid choice for those looking for an effective compact camera, but it may not be suitable for those with advanced video needs or who require greater usage flexibility.
